why is compromise importamt to solving problems in a democracy?

Answers

Answered by Ms. Sue
The very nature of a democracy demands compromise. We take different opinions and meld them together by compromising to produce a viable nation.

If we didn't compromise, we'd either have a dictator or a nonfunctional government.
